10,000 Steps: Exploring our Footprint and Her Long Walk
for Water

Silver Center for the Arts
​Plymouth State University

​November 9 - December 2, 2015


Ten Thousand Steps is a collaborative, interdisciplinary art project that culminates in a monumental installation in Silver Center for the Arts. Designed to raise awareness of global water issues through the topic of access, which currently affects almost eight hundred million people. The project involved PSU students in collaboration, public-engagement, research, critical thinking, design, printmaking, exhibition curating, service, as well as project production, installation, and marketing. Presented in collaboration with Christine Destrempes of Art For Water, Kimberly Ritchie and her PSU Color & Design class students, Brian Eisenhauer of The Center for the Environment, and Jane Barry of International Education Week.
